Russell's Story
It has been an interesting journey. After DHS started going by my middle name, Scott, or RS, or R Scott, depending on who I am talking to. Graduated Essex C.C., U. of Denver (BA psych), New York Univ. (MA counseling), U of MD College Park (PhD counseling psychology). Licensed psychologist since 1986. US Navy Submarine Service 2 yrs active duty, 4 yrs reserves. Served on a Fleet Ballistic Missile submarine and a diesel boat as a sonar tech, STS2(SS). Psychologist, MD Army National Guard 2 yrs. Psychologist, MD Air National Guard 2 yrs. Retired Lt Col, USAF. Have had a variety of mental health jobs, civilian and military. Last clinical job was at Howard AFB, Republic of Panama. The hospital on Howard served all military service members, their families and the civilians working in embassies throughout Central and South America. and the emergency department. Most of my time in the AF was in jobs related to planning, executing or teaching psychological operations and Information Operations. Last assignment in the AF was at the AF Research Laboratory, Wright-Patterson AFB, OH. I am currently a contractor conducting behavioral influences intelligence analyses and producing psychological profiles on bad guys (remotely of course). Married 30+ yrs to the lovely (and very patient) Rita. Two daughters, 3 grandkids. We have had a mastiff and a clumber spaniel and currently have two "designer dogs" Cavalier King Charles Spaniel/Miniature Poodle mixes (Monk & Oscar from two different breeders with very different personalities). We have down-sized considerably since the mastiff! We live outside of Dayton OH in a house we could never afford in the Baltimore/DC area. Do not miss the traffic congestion or the merchant/mechanics trying to pull a fast one. Do miss Jim and Betty Rogers whom I have known since 1969 ... and the occasional pit beef sandwich, bull roasts and steamed crabs.
